Dangers Associated With LASIK



Lots of people undertaking LASIK surgical treatment are primarily concerned concerning prospective risks related to the procedure. While LASIK is a risk-free and reliable therapy for vision Correction, like any kind of procedure, it does feature some threats.

The most usual dangers associated with LASIK include dry eyes, glow, halos, and problem driving at evening in the prompt postoperative duration. These signs are usually momentary and enhance as the eyes heal.

In uncommon situations, even more major issues such as infection, corneal flap issues, and vision loss can happen, yet the likelihood of these difficulties is incredibly reduced when the surgical treatment is executed by an experienced and seasoned ophthalmologist. It's important to discuss these threats with your medical professional during the consultation to ensure you have a clear understanding of what to expect.

Qualification Misconceptions



Some people wrongly believe that just individuals with serious vision issues are qualified for LASIK surgery. Nevertheless, this is an usual false impression. While LASIK is typically associated with dealing with high levels of n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ism, people with milder vision concerns can additionally be qualified prospects. As a matter of fact, developments in LASIK innovation have increased the variety of treatable prescriptions, enabling more people to take advantage of the treatment.

LASIK qualification is determined via a thorough eye examination by a qualified ophthalmologist. Variables such as corneal thickness, eye wellness, and general medical history play an important duty in evaluating a person's viability for the surgery.

Even individuals over 40, that might have presbyopia (age-related problem concentrating on close things), can potentially undertake LASIK or various other vision Correction procedures.
